
导言:当TP钱包在转账时提示“签名失败”,用户常感到困惑与焦虑。本文从技术原因、排查步骤、安全建议到跨链与未来趋势,提供全面、可操作的指导。
一、常见原因与快速排查
- 网络或节点问题:所连RPC节点响应异常或链ID不匹配,会导致交易构建或签名失败。排查:切换官方或知名公共RPC,重启钱包。

- 应用版本/缓存:钱包版本过旧或缓存异常可能造成签名模块错误。排查:更新TP钱包、清理缓存或重装并恢复助记词(谨慎操作,先备份助记词)。
- 密钥/硬件问题:私钥损坏、硬件钱包未连接或权限未授予会拒绝签名。排查:检查硬件设备连接,尝试重插、重启或在设备上确认签名请求。
- 签名方法不兼容:DApp使用的签名类型(eth_sign、personal_sign、EIP-712)与钱包调用不匹配时会失败。排查:在DApp或钱包中切换签名方式,或使用不同钱包尝试。
- 合约/交易参数问题:目标合约拒绝交易(如fallback revert)、nonce冲突或gas不足,均可导致签名或上链失败。排查:检查交易构建参数、nonce、估算gas,并确认合约地址与ABI正确。
二、跨链桥与签名失败的关联
跨链桥通常涉及跨链消息、跨域签名或中继节点。常见问题:桥端链ID不一致、跨链合约未批准代币、桥服务节点延迟或签名格式差异。建议使用官方跨链桥、确认代币锁仓/释放流程,并在桥操作前提高gas与耐心等待跨链确认。
三、全球化智能金融服务的影响
随着钱包提供商扩展到全球智能金融(多资产管理、fiat on/off ramps、合规KYC),签名流程可能增加额外授权步骤(例如支付授权、合规签署)。用户需注意KYC合规带来的额外提示,并选择支持多链、接口稳定的服务提供商。
四、防电子窃听与安全最佳实践
- 优先使用硬件钱包或TP钱包的安全模块进行离线/本地签名。
- 在不可信网络环境下避免签名重要交易;使用VPN、私人热点或移动数据替代公共Wi-Fi。
- 使用多重签名(multisig)或门限签名方案(TSS)降低单点私钥被盗风险。
- 定期检查App权限、升级系统补丁、启用生物识别和PIN保护。
五、合约兼容与签名标准
不同链和合约对签名数据结构与验证逻辑有差异(如EVM链与非EVM、EIP-712结构化数据签名)。开发者应提供兼容多个签名方法的接口,用户在DApp交互前核验签名请求内容,避免盲签(blind signing)。
六、交易隐私与防前跑措施
提高隐私可通过:使用隐私工具(zk、混币、Shielded tx)、私有RPC或通过中继服务提交交易、交易合并与延迟广播以防MEV/前跑。需要注意监管合规问题:隐私技术虽有用但在某些地区受限。
七、实用故障处理步骤(快速清单)
1. 确认网络/链ID是否正确;切换主网/测试网或RPC并重试。
2. 更新TP钱包至最新版,清理缓存;必要时重装并用助记词恢复。
3. 检查硬件钱包连接、手机蓝牙或USB授权。
4. 查看DApp签名类型,尝试使用其他钱包或WalletConnect。
5. 在区块链浏览器检查nonce、余额与合约状态;如有挂起交易,先处理旧nonce。
6. 若涉及跨链,等待桥端确认或联系桥方客服。
八、市场未来评估与预测
- 互操作性与跨链基础设施(跨链桥、跨链消息标准)将持续发展,但短期内仍面临安全与信任问题。桥的合规化与保险机制会成为服务必需。
- 隐私技术(zk、MPC、多签)会被更多机构性与个人用户采用,但监管压力会促使隐私功能与合规性并行设计。
- 智能金融全球化将推动钱包功能从“签名工具”向“金融网关”演化,提供合规的法币通道、资产托管与跨链投融资服务。
结论与建议:面对“签名失败”,用户先从网络、版本、硬件与签名方法入手排查;涉及跨链和合约交互时,多做确认并优先使用官方或审计通过的桥与合约。为了防电子窃听与资产被盗,推荐使用硬件钱包、离线签名和多签策略。展望未来,跨链互通与隐私技术将并行发展,但安全与合规将决定市场格局的主导方向。
评论
Lily
文章很实用,按着清单一步步排查就解决了我的签名失败问题,感谢分享!
张晨
关于EIP-712和盲签的提醒很到位,之前差点在不明请求上盲签了。
CryptoGuy88
跨链桥的风险分析简洁明了,希望桥方能尽快加强审计与保险机制。
小米
防电子窃听那节很重要,已决定把主要资产转到硬件钱包并启用多签。